I usually feel I'm in the "TeaZone" especially when I'm making tea gongfu for my sister and brothers. The TGY or whatever else we have always comes out delicious. Though sometimes (usually when I'm alone) my tea can come out a little bitter... or sometimes I don't use quite enough leaf and it tastes really watered down.

No tea yet, but I'm thinking a quick pot of my Jungpana estate Darjeeling. Later perhaps a gongfu session with some of my dwindling stock of sheng pu samples.

I went with sometimes - since a lot of my tea consumption is at work, it's not ideal, and I know I could do better. At home I get it right more of the time, but simultaneously let it steep too long a bit more often, partially just because I tend to take less finicky teas to work (in case I forget about them for 10 minutes), so at home I'm doing most of my experimenting.

Snowbud all day at work, thinking some Peach Flambee (which is almost gone, sad day!) with dinner.
